				<description>&#060;p&#062;I am not that familiar with your style Gigi (feel like I should know better). But based on your self-description of IT/Apple/Full Bust, here are some dresses I think might work.&#060;/p&#062;
&#060;p&#062;Caslon shirtdress -- v neck is good for fuller bust, mid-section looks forgiving and nothing particularly emphasizes the shoulder line.&#060;/p&#062;
&#060;p&#062;Haute HIppie shirtdress -- similar thinking. &#038;nbsp;Not on sale though.&#060;/p&#062;
&#060;p&#062;(Wildcard) Leith trapeze dresses -- I think apples look great in dresses like this. &#038;nbsp;The neckline is open enough to suit a fuller bust and it also shows off your shoulder line in a good way. &#038;nbsp;Could also be an epic fail though...&#060;/p&#062;

				<description>&#060;p&#062;I tried the navy tahari one (there's a pic in my post with the halogen leather jacket).  I think the neckline detail is great!  I didn't keep it, though, partly because the waist length was wrong for me, but also because I found the fabric a bit clingy, which might be relevant to you.  It's a ponte-like material and also lined, and personally I'd find it hot for summer.  Lighter than scuba though!  I also liked the shoulder shape because it strengthens my weak shoulder line but that means you might NOT like it.  I suspect the shoulder line on the Ellen Tracy might do the same.&#060;/p&#062;
&#060;p&#062;Of these, I like the floral best for you.  The dark floral pattern seems very you, and the chiffon fabric would be light and floaty.  Yes it's poly but if the dress is sufficiently floaty it's usually ok.&#060;/p&#062;
